'Formula 1: Drive to Survive' Gets Season 8 Premiere Date on Netflix
The 2026 F1 season is beginning with livery and suit reveals, which means a new season of Drive to Survive is also almost here!
Netflix has just unveiled the release date for the docuseries, which will give a behind-the-scenes look at the motor sport’s 2025 Formula 1 season.

Here’s a synopsis: Offering unprecedented access, this new season will once again take fans behind the scenes, to witness first-hand how the drivers and teams prepare to battle it out for the 2025 FIA Formula 1 World Championship. The series will offer never-before-seen footage as we follow new team lineups, management takedowns, fierce friendships and bitter rivalries of another high-octane season on the Formula 1 circuit.
This season, we can expect to see the various driver changes at Red Bull, Racing Bulls and Alpine, plus the mid-season exit of Red Bull boss Christian Horner!
Drivers expected to be featured in some capacity include the full 2025 lineup – recently engaged Alex Albon, Carlos Sainz, Charles Leclerc, Esteban Ocon, Fernando Alonso, Franco Colapinto, Gabriel Bortoleto, George Russell, Isack Hadjar, Jack Doohan, Kimi Antonelli, Lance Stroll, Lando Norris, Lewis Hamilton, Liam Lawson, Max Verstappen, Nico Hulkenberg, Oliver Bearman, Oscar Piastri, Pierre Gasly and Yuki Tsunoda.
Formula 1: Drive to Survive season eight is set to premiere on February 27th.
